The DataPower REST Management Interface
DataPower provides a comprehensive REST API for management operations. The endpoint we’re interested in is:
GET https://<datapower-host>:5554/mgmt/status/<domain>/GatewayScriptStatus
This endpoint returns the same information as the CLI show gatewayscript-status command, but in JSON format that’s perfect for automation.
Quick Start: Monitoring Script
Here’s a simple bash one-liner to continuously monitor GatewayScript availability:
while true; do
curl -k -u admin:password -X GET \
https://1.2.3.4:5554/mgmt/status/default/GatewayScriptStatus 2>&1 | \
grep Available;
echo;
done
What This Does:
- Continuously polls the GatewayScript status endpoint
- Extracts the “Available” field showing engine availability
- Displays results in real-time
- Runs indefinitely until stopped (Ctrl+C)
Sample Output:
"Available": 8,
"Available": 8,
"Available": 8,
"Available": 8,
Understanding the Response
The full JSON response from the REST API endpoint contains valuable metrics. Here’s the actual output structure:
$ curl -k -u admin:password -X GET https://1.2.3.4:5554/mgmt/status/default/GatewayScriptStatus
{
"_links": {
"self": {
"href": "/mgmt/status/default/GatewayScriptStatus"
},
"doc": {
"href": "/mgmt/docs/status/GatewayScriptStatus"
}
},
"GatewayScriptStatus": {
"Available": 8,
"InUse": 0,
"QueuedWork": 0,
"Failed": 0
}
}
Note: The values are returned as integers (not strings), making them easy to parse and compare in monitoring scripts.
Key Fields:
| Field | Description | What to Monitor |
|---|---|---|
Available |
Total engines configured (integer) | Should match CPU core count unless on a physical appliance |
InUse |
Engines currently executing (integer) | Watch for approaching Available count |
QueuedWork |
Requests waiting for engines (integer) | RED FLAG if > 0 |
Failed |
GatewayScript execution errors (integer) | Should always be 0 |
Enhanced Monitoring Script
For production monitoring, you’ll want more detail. Here’s an enhanced version:
#!/bin/bash
# Configuration
DATAPOWER_HOST="9.37.230.250"
DATAPOWER_PORT="5554"
DOMAIN="default"
USERNAME="admin"
PASSWORD="Level2was"
POLL_INTERVAL=5 # seconds
# Colors for output
RED='\033[0;31m'
YELLOW='\033[1;33m'
GREEN='\033[0;32m'
NC='\033[0m' # No Color
echo "Monitoring GatewayScript Status on ${DATAPOWER_HOST}:${DATAPOWER_PORT}"
echo "Domain: ${DOMAIN}"
echo "Poll Interval: ${POLL_INTERVAL}s"
echo "Press Ctrl+C to stop"
echo "----------------------------------------"
while true; do
# Get current timestamp
TIMESTAMP=$(date '+%Y-%m-%d %H:%M:%S')
# Query the REST API
RESPONSE=$(curl -k -s -u ${USERNAME}:${PASSWORD} \
-X GET \
"https://${DATAPOWER_HOST}:${DATAPOWER_PORT}/mgmt/status/${DOMAIN}/GatewayScriptStatus")
# Extract values using grep and sed (values are integers, not strings)
AVAILABLE=$(echo "$RESPONSE" | grep -o '"Available" : [0-9]*' | sed 's/"Available" : //')
INUSE=$(echo "$RESPONSE" | grep -o '"InUse" : [0-9]*' | sed 's/"InUse" : //')
QUEUED=$(echo "$RESPONSE" | grep -o '"QueuedWork" : [0-9]*' | sed 's/"QueuedWork" : //')
FAILURES=$(echo "$RESPONSE" | grep -o '"Failed" : [0-9]*' | sed 's/"Failed" : //')
# Calculate utilization percentage
if [ -n "$AVAILABLE" ] && [ "$AVAILABLE" -gt 0 ]; then
UTILIZATION=$((INUSE * 100 / AVAILABLE))
else
UTILIZATION=0
fi
# Determine status color
if [ "$QUEUED" -gt 0 ]; then
STATUS_COLOR=$RED
STATUS="CRITICAL"
elif [ "$UTILIZATION" -ge 80 ]; then
STATUS_COLOR=$YELLOW
STATUS="WARNING"
else
STATUS_COLOR=$GREEN
STATUS="OK"
fi
# Display status
echo -e "${TIMESTAMP} | ${STATUS_COLOR}${STATUS}${NC} | Available: ${AVAILABLE} | In-Use: ${INUSE} (${UTILIZATION}%) | Queued: ${QUEUED} | Failures: ${FAILURES}"
# Alert on critical conditions
if [ "$QUEUED" -gt 0 ]; then
echo -e "${RED}⚠️ ALERT: ${QUEUED} requests queued - engines saturated!${NC}"
fi
if [ "$FAILURES" -gt 0 ]; then
echo -e "${RED}⚠️ ALERT: ${FAILURES} GatewayScript failures detected!${NC}"
fi
sleep $POLL_INTERVAL
done
Sample Output:
Monitoring GatewayScript Status on 1.2.3.4:5554
Domain: default
Poll Interval: 5s
Press Ctrl+C to stop
----------------------------------------
2026-03-03 14:30:00 | OK | Available: 8 | In-Use: 2 (25%) | Queued: 0 | Failures: 0
2026-03-03 14:30:05 | OK | Available: 8 | In-Use: 3 (37%) | Queued: 0 | Failures: 0
2026-03-03 14:30:10 | WARNING | Available: 8 | In-Use: 7 (87%) | Queued: 0 | Failures: 0
2026-03-03 14:30:15 | CRITICAL | Available: 8 | In-Use: 8 (100%) | Queued: 5 | Failures: 0
⚠️ ALERT: 5 requests queued - engines saturated!
Troubleshooting
Connection Refused
curl: (7) Failed to connect to 1.2.3.4 port 5554: Connection refused
Solutions:
- Verify REST Management Interface is enabled
- Check firewall rules
- Confirm port 5554 is correct (default for REST interface)
Authentication Failed
curl: (22) The requested URL returned error: 401 Unauthorized
Solutions:
- Verify username and password
- Check user has appropriate permissions
- Ensure user is not locked out
Empty Response
Solutions:
- Verify domain name is correct
- Check GatewayScript is enabled in the domain
- Confirm API Gateway service is running
